Understanding Dog Behavior and Ultrasonic Repellents
Dogs, much like humans, have unique personalities and behavior patterns that can vary greatly. Understanding their communication methods is essential for effective training and modification. Canines primarily express themselves through body language, vocalizations, and scent marking. Recognizing these cues is key to interpreting a dog’s needs and emotions, allowing owners to respond appropriately. For instance, a dog’s tail wagging can signal happiness or nervousness, depending on the context.
Ultrasonic systems, such as drop-proof electronic dog repellents, are designed to address specific behavioral issues. These devices emit high-frequency sounds that are inaudible to humans but can be irritating to dogs, encouraging them to avoid certain areas or behaviors. This method leverages a dog’s sensitivity to ultrasonic waves to modify their actions, especially when traditional training techniques may not be effective. The use of such repellents should always consider the well-being and overall health of the canine companion, ensuring they do not cause any discomfort or stress.
The Science Behind Drop-Proof Electronic Dog Repellers
The science behind drop-proof electronic dog repellers revolves around using ultrasonic sound waves to deter canine behavior issues like excessive barking or aggression. These devices emit high-frequency sounds, generally in the range of 25–64 kHz, which are inaudible to humans but uncomfortable for dogs. The principle is based on the fact that dogs, with their more sensitive hearing than humans, find these frequencies irritative, prompting them to stop the behavior that triggered the repeller.
Drop-proof electronic dog repellers are designed to be durable and weather-resistant, ensuring they can withstand outdoor conditions without failing or losing effectiveness. This feature is crucial as it allows for consistent application of the ultrasonic signal when training dogs in various environments. The devices often incorporate advanced technology like adjustable sensitivity settings and motion detectors to ensure precise activation, minimizing false triggers and enhancing their overall reliability.
Training Techniques to Enhance System Effectiveness
Training techniques play a pivotal role in enhancing the effectiveness of a canine behavior modification ultrasonic system, particularly when it comes to drop-proof electronic dog repellers. One key approach is positive reinforcement, where owners reward desired behaviors with treats or praise. This not only encourages the dog but also strengthens their association with the ultrasonic device as a positive experience rather than a deterrent.
Additionally, gradual desensitization is a powerful method. It involves exposing the dog to the ultrasonic signal at low intensity levels initially, allowing them to become accustomed to it without triggering an immediate reaction. As the dog learns to ignore the signal, the intensity can be gradually increased, making the system more effective over time. Consistency and patience are essential during this process, as each dog has its unique learning curve.
